Elastic strains on the free surface and the interface with the rigid body as structural elements of an inhomogeneous body.

- The problem of elastic wave reflection on the free surface and on the interface with the rigid bidy is investigated in the approximation of geometrical acoustics. In both cases, the interface is considered as a structural element of an inhomogeneous body, which is characterized by dimensions and a set of physical-mechanical parameters. In the continuum mechanics the interface is generally viewed as an infinitely thin layer. Analytical expressions for the Fresnel coefficients allowing us to determine the strain components on the boundary are found at the normal incidence of P and SV waves. The dependences of the Fresnel coefficients and the strain amplitudes as functions of interface thickness and the elastic properties of contacting bodies are calculated and analyzed.
